The documentary FREEWAY: CRACK IN THE SYSTEM tells the story of how the infiltration of crack cocaine devastated inner-city neighborhoods across the US. The film centers around the rise, fall, and redemption of Freeway Rick Ross, a street hustler who became the King of Crack, and journalist Gary Webb, who exposed the CIA's involvement in the drug war.
